It's three years today since I put my family through the harrowing experience of my brain surgeries at Stanford.

This is a day we celebrate every year. My son, David insisted he take the shop today so that I can do whatever gives me pleasure - let's see, that would be gardening today! This is a day when I give thanks to God for creating such talented people as Dr. Steinberg and his wonderful staff. My thanks to all of you beautiful and amazing Stanford folks.

I thought I had recoverd completely within six months of my surgeries, but in retrospect I find every year I see improvement in my thinking and performance. It's only in the past six months that I've begun to make real progress with my business. ANd only in the past month have I found that the fingers of my left hand are no longer weak.

People with amazing ideas have been literally walking through the doors to my shop sharing with me their thoughts and experiencees regarding health and well-being. I am listening and taking their advice. They've brought to me daily meditation, a Hypnotism for Weight Loss class, Isagenix a nutrional food source, Commanding Wealth by Assara Lovejoy, and Dr. Jangarrd a local naturopath who has prescribed nutritional supplements that have restored my energy. I always believed Whidbey Island to be a magical and healing place, I'm learning that much of this emmantes from the special people who've chosen to make their home here.
